What’s the Average Salary for Sous Chef Jobs in NYC?

On average, Sous Chefs who work in New York City can expect to earn around $67,503 per year. This amount is 17.02% higher than the U.S. average salary for this same position — making NYC a highly attractive option for those who wish to succeed in the culinary industry while receiving competitive pay.

Moreover, NYC has the highest average Sous Chef salary compared to other major cities like Miami ($60,151), Los Angeles ($62,954) and Chicago ($58,638).

Legal Requirements Applicable to Sous Chef Jobs in NYC

Let’s take a look at some of the state laws and regulations that NYC-based Sous Chefs should know and adhere to.

1. Pay transparency

Under New York State’s Pay Transparency Law, businesses with four or more employees have to disclose compensation ranges for job openings, promotions and transfers. This law also prevents employers from “retaliating” against employees who opt to discuss their compensation with their coworkers.

2. Food handler training and certification

Many NYC restaurants require employees whose daily responsibilities include preparing and serving dishes to have a food handler’s certificate. As for newly hired employees who have not yet obtained this card, they must do so within 30 days.

3. Minimum age for employment

Although it’s not always part of their primary responsibilities, Sous Chefs may occasionally assist in hiring new back-of-house staff members. That said, they must make sure to only accept applicants who are at least 14 years old, provided that the applicant has working papers. However, the legal work hours for minors (employees aged 14 to 18) vary depending on their age.
